实现思路: 将带空格分隔的字符串split成数组,利用数组sort()排序方法,在该方法里面用chartCodeAt()方法比对元素间同位置的字符的ASCII码(同一位置字符的ASCII码相同则继续比对下一个字符)
js怎样获取字符ASCII码?
如果是ASCII字符,可以用charCodeAt()方法取得,但如果超出ASCII范围,返回的结果是Unicode编码.如果要查询ANSI编码,可能必须查询码表,而这个码表你可以在网上找到,也可以自己写一个.js对一个字符串根据ASCII码从小到大排序(字典序)
给您推荐相同类型的内容:
电脑如何上陌陌
需要使用到安卓虚拟器。安卓虚拟器有两种,一直比较简单的免安装的虚拟器,不过运行的有点卡。另外一种需要安装的,文件也比较大。复杂但是运行速度还可以x0dx0a陌陌电脑版安装图文教程。x0dx0ax0dx0a免安装陌陌电脑版x0d移动端网站优化需注意哪些要点?
1、定位和页面设计。无论是PC端还是移动端,网站都要考虑清楚消费群体的定位问题。虽然智能手机用户数量非常普及,但是要明白中国的大部分手机用户使用的还是2G网络,一直高 喊的3G、4G手机用户只有大约15%左右。所以,在页面设计时,要考虑到用CSS怎么设计网页头部
在div+css布局中,一般都像下面这样来整体构架的:<div id="header"><div><div id="center"&js怎么删除css的行内样式
其实js很不好用的,一般都使用jquery来写,改变样式的话我会使用两种方法使用jquery中的.css()函数改变样式,这中方法很好用,可以在触发事件的时候任意操作某个元素的样式。自定义一个class名字,比如.yangshi{} ,在鼠标在电脑上不见了怎么办啊
1. 鼠标突然不见了怎么办 这种情况一般分两种情况来分别看待: 1.只是鼠标指针不可见,但是可以感觉到鼠标的确存在,比如点右键可以出现相关选项。 这样的话,应该是系统问题,可以通过修复鼠标指针文件来恢复,,从健康的机子上考一个过怎么禁止网页自动跳转?
问题一:如何避免网页自动跳转ie 工具 ―― Internet选项 ―― 高级 ―― 禁止动态js脚本 火狐 工具 ―― 选项 ―― 内容 ―― 启用javascript去掉问题二:怎么阻止浏览器自动跳出的页面?可以css中,绝对定位和相对定位是什么意思?通常都是怎么用?
1、新建一个html文件输入两个div标签,接着使用style属性,分别给div设置为绝对定位absolute和相对定位relative,让他们其中全部向左移动20px,向上移动30px的距离:2、然后保存文件打开浏览器看看效果,位置显示还css中的绝对定位和相对定位
关于position属性 position开放分类: HTML、CSS、WEB标准、网页设计 bottomrighttopz-indexleftposition版本:CSS2兼容性:IE4+ NS4+ 继承性:无【JS算法】JS数据结构
数组: 是由相同类型的元素的集合所组成的数据结构,分配一块连续的内存来存储。知道第一个元素的内存地址,加上下标(偏移量)就能找到第2或N个。 数组随机访问的速度快,增加和删除则慢(因为删除index2,后面的3-n都要往前挪一位)使用js或jq控制一个div,当滚动到页面顶部的时候固定在顶部,离开可继续滚动吗?
代码:x0dx0a•$(function(){x0dx0ax0dx0a•获取要定位元素距离浏览器顶部的距离x0dx0ax0dx0a•var navH = $(".nav").offset().tovue 引入自定义js 并使用
1.首先创建一个js ex: test.js const referrerPhone = [ { pattern: ^1[3456789]d{9}$, message: '手机号格式不正确', t电脑如何用usb使用手机网络上网
1、电脑无法连接网络的情况,可以通过usb共享手机流量上网,首先将手机与电脑通过数据线连接。2、手机端点开设置,选择更多连接方式。3、打开手机usb网络共享。4、可以看到usb共享已开启,如果开启失败多试几次就可以。5、打开电脑网络和共享中用js怎么设置单元格的边框
直接换是不可以的关于单元格的线形还是颜色,这些都是先选择线的粗细然后再加边框,(必须有个去边框的过程不然直接修改是不可以的)具体过程如下 单元你想要改的单元格 右键 设置单元格格式 边框 然后你点一下无边框那个 然后选择线的样式或者粗细 然世界十大黑胶唱片机品牌
世界十大黑胶唱片机品牌1、audio-technica铁三角铁三角创立于1962年日本,全球著名耳机厂商,致力于音响器材的设计、制造、行销的大型跨国公司,产品以高质量、高耐久性、高性价比著称。于2002年成立北京分公司,主要从事铁三角音在电脑上怎么安装软件?
随着电脑的普及和信息技术的发展,网络成为了我们生活中不可缺少的一部分。我们常常会用计算机来下载一些软件,对于一些电脑新手来说,还是有的困难的,那么电脑上该怎么正确安装软件呢?接下来小编就给大家带来电脑上安装软件的教程。具体步骤如下:1、我CSS中li标签的项目符号可以在IE和火狐中显示,但是在世界之窗和360中不能显示,请问是为什么?
世界之窗和360只不过是个外壳,内核都是IE。你的 li 的项目符号不显示可能是这些“外壳”浏览器设置了默认的 style。如果要确保相同的显示,只有采用统一的 style,针对 li 的 style 可以是这样:UL LI { list-简述在网页制作CSS样式有哪三种类型?每个类型的作用是什么?
准确点说应该有4种类型的CSS样式表1.HTML文件行中的样式表2.HTML文件头中的样式表3.连接到HTML文件中的样式表4.输入到HTML文件中的样式表前两种是内部样式表 后两种是外部样式表CSS的作用主要是1.实现对HTML代码的补充CSS中如何控制段落间的距离
CSS中如何控制段落间的距离方法:1、line-height为20px案例,DIV+CSS代码:<!DOCTYPE html> <html> <head> &HTML5+CSS3小实例:全屏导航栏菜单
HTML5+CSS3实现全屏导航栏菜单,悬停在右上角的小图标,点击以圆形扩散的方式绽开全屏导航栏,这种方式的导航栏很吸睛,运用也越来越广,赶紧学起来呀! 效果: 源码:1.boder-radis圆角的制作2.linear-gradDIV+CSS怎么适配浏览器?
DIV+CSS适配浏览器,意思就是对于div+css的布局,在各个浏览器中的显示,而且是正确的显示,也就是IE,chrom、firefox等等,要满足也就是说在各个浏览器中不会出现错位等问题,要实现这些就需要通过hack,或者是说一些浏览器div+CSS 网页布局分两栏时,如何让两栏同等高度。请求帮忙,急!!谢谢?
因为你使用了float,所以left和right都已经不在正常的流中了,所以他们之间的以及父元素之间的高度都是互相独立的。所以要想不使用javascript,而又要这两者之间有关系的话就不能使用float。通常要进行准确的布局都是通过tabcss怎么让一张图片适应任何屏幕大小的电脑平铺?
不定义div的宽度,以及父div的宽度即可。来做一个导航:<style typr="textcss">*{margin:0padding:0border:0}.navbg{background:怎么把电脑设置默认wps
1. 电脑怎么默认wps 安装正常的话,打开wps office配置工具-高级兼容设置--框中 勾选,然后确定即可。wps office安装的时候就有选择的,默认是用wps office打开office的word、excel、p网页前台设计,css怎么实现文字竖排版?
一、使用writing-mode属性语法:writing-mode:lr-tb或writing-mode:tb-rl参数:1、lr-tb:从左向右,从上往下2、tb-rl:从上往下,从右向左运行代码发现,IE显示正常,火狐却不行,所以不建议js里面怎么解析从java对象
<%CM cm=new CM()%>var fs='<%=cm.getMoney()%>'java是服务器端运行的代码 js是客户端运行的代码,js需要运行的数据要么是服务学习php必须要学习js吗
先不用学JS, 等你的PHP学到一定的程度,就会发现语言之间有许多地方是相通的, 到时再学JS也来得及。PHP里有相当的思想与JS是一致的, 致于面对对象的部分就更是如此。先抓紧时间,学会一种,什么都学,会造成什么也学不好,学到混乱了。PHJS如何获取对象的父对象(非文档对象)
在js中,我们时常用到用iframe做系统框架,在子页面也,父页面之间的值传递是一个问题,下面是js获取父窗体和子窗体的对象js:1.在iframe子页面中获取父页面的元素:a>window.parent.document这个是跪求 蛋糕上的草莓 百度云免费在线观看资源
分享链接:https:pan.baidu.comshareinit?surl=GrvwvCsSfDX0y4OB1GjKgA提取码:k65z 复制这段内容后打开百度网盘App,操作更方便哦。作品相关简介:《蛋糕上的草莓》是由日本TB电脑打开网页速度慢怎么办
可以清理浏览器的缓存来提升打开速度,具体操作如下:1、打开Internet Explorer的属性界面,然后在常规界面点击“删除cookies”,然后点击确定。2:然后点击删除文件,在勾选的地方打勾,然后再点击确定。3:同样是常规界面,点Js隐式转换
1 .if 判断,其余类型转为布尔类型 2 .比较操作符 == 3 .+,- 4 . 点 号操作符 5 .在对数字,字符串进行点操作方法时,默认将数字,字符串转成对象 5 .关系符比较的时候 1 . 1 .nul